摘要
Heavy-metal sodalite: NdIII reacts with [MoV(CN) 8]3- in methanol to form a new 3D framework consisting of cyanide-bridged NdIII and MoIV ions. The anionic framework (red and blue in the picture) has a cage structure similar to that of the zeolite sodalite and contains hexagonal channels filled by methanol molecules and [NdIIICH2O)8]3+ ions (green spheres).
